Transaction 5977767db3a2f5fbecc1276f028378515c90b14956e3aef120b8a57153337517
1 Input
2 Outputs
- 5977767db3a2f5fbecc1276f028378515c90b14956e3aef120b8a57153337517:0
- 5977767db3a2f5fbecc1276f028378515c90b14956e3aef120b8a57153337517:1
value 15830115
address 1EEwLA1G2tAAC247uhMtVkkWtBNu6zEo2V
value 122712902
address 13AHTPaVbbkid23JgrQQJ4JtAJo5VhiKFN